Fix It or Replace It? How We Decide

Most door problems don't need a new door — they need the right adjustment. Here's how we approach it:
A repair or adjustment handles:
Seasonal swelling that makes the door bind in humid months
Loose hinges or a sagging top corner from worn-out screw holes
Worn-out handle, deadbolt, or lockset that needs swapping

A new door is the better investment when:

The door frame itself is twisted, split, or water-damaged beyond shimming
Rot, delamination, or cracks running through the door core
An exterior door that no longer seals against drafts, water, or insects
You're upgrading the home's look before selling or after a renovation
We give you an honest answer on-site — if a $50 hinge fix solves it, that's what we recommend.

What We See in Downers Grove Homes

Door problems in Downers Grove track closely with the home's age and construction. In pre-war bungalows and Sears Roebuck kit homes near the historic district and Main Street Station, original solid-wood doors have often been painted dozens of times over the decades — building up layers that throw off clearances. These homes also tend to have settled unevenly, leaving frames that are no longer square. We shim, plane, and rehang to work within the frame as it sits today rather than fighting the settling. In mid-century ranches across the 60515 and 60516 ZIP codes — Denburn Woods, Prince Pond, Downers Grove Gardens — the most common issue is hollow-core interior doors with stripped hinge screw holes. Sixty-year-old wood framing dries out and loses its grip, so the top hinge pulls away and the door drags on the carpet. We drill out the old holes, glue in hardwood dowels, and re-seat the screws for a permanent hold.
Newer teardown rebuilds along Fairview Avenue and the I-355 corridor usually have builder-grade hollow-core doors and basic brass hardware that homeowners want to upgrade. We install solid-core replacements, modern lever handles, and privacy locksets — a straightforward swap that makes a noticeable difference in how the home feels. Exterior doors in any era of Downers Grove home need proper weatherstripping for Illinois winters — we check and replace the seal on every exterior door job.

My old Downers Grove home has settled — can you still make the doors work properly?

Yes. Foundation settling is common in pre-war and mid-century homes throughout the village, and it throws door frames out of square. Rather than ripping out the frame, we work with the geometry as-is — planing the door edge, adjusting hinge placement, and re-cutting the strike plate so the latch catches cleanly. This approach saves money and avoids unnecessary drywall and trim damage.

Why does my interior door drag on the carpet only when the heat is off?

DuPage County humidity swings are the culprit. In summer, interior wood doors absorb moisture and expand — especially the bottom rail, which is closest to floor-level humidity. When the heat kicks on in winter, the wood dries and shrinks back. We plane the binding edge with just enough clearance to handle the seasonal swing without leaving a visible gap in the dry months.

The top hinge on my bedroom door keeps pulling away from the frame — how do you fix that permanently?

This is extremely common in 1950s–1970s Downers Grove ranches with softwood pine frames. The original screws lose their grip as the wood dries and compresses over decades. We drill out the worn holes, glue in hardwood dowels, let them set, then re-drill and drive 3-inch screws that bite into the wall stud behind the jamb. That hinge isn't going anywhere.

I want to upgrade from builder-grade hollow-core doors to solid core — is that a straight swap?

Usually yes, if the new door is the same dimensions. Solid-core doors are significantly heavier than hollow-core, so we upgrade to heavier-gauge hinges and use longer screws that anchor into the stud — not just the jamb. This is one of the most popular upgrades we do in newer Downers Grove teardown rebuilds where builders installed the cheapest possible doors.

My exterior door lets in a cold draft at the bottom — do I need a new door or just new weatherstripping?

In most cases, a new door sweep and fresh weatherstripping solve the problem completely — especially if the door itself is still solid and the frame isn't warped. We check the threshold height and adjust it so the sweep compresses evenly across the full width. For Downers Grove winters, a proper seal at the bottom of the door makes a real difference in heating costs and comfort.
